What is a mental health crisis, almost speaking

Textbooks define a mental health crisis as a severe interruption in idea, state of mind, or behavior that runs the risk of harm or significantly impairs operating. In method, it resembles a few repeating clusters:

image

    Imminent self-harm or suicide risk Threats towards others or escalating aggression Acute psychosis, mania, or severe dissociation that hinders judgment Overwhelming anxiousness or panic where functioning collapses Complex pain or injury actions set off by current events

In frontline work, dilemma does not always existing with an analysis tag. That is why a course in initial response to a mental health crisis concentrates on feature and threat rather than medical diagnosis. We analyze what the person can do right now, where the threat rests, and what sustains can be set in motion in mins, hours, and days.

Evidence, not guesswork

Accredited mental health courses are improved current research and national guidelines. When material is audited, carriers have to show placement with evidence on self-destruction danger factors, protective factors, brief interventions, and reference effectiveness. For instance, asking directly about self-destruction does not raise threat, a finding constantly sustained throughout numerous studies. Accredited training drives that direct home and provides manuscripts for individuals that really feel awkward asking. It also clarifies what to do after the concern: just how to weigh intent, strategy, implies, and duration, exactly how to develop a safety plan that is concrete, and when to include emergency situation services.

Without that grounding, -responders fail to platitudes or stay clear of the topic totally. I have actually examined lots of incident reports where the crucial concern was never ever asked. The difference after official training is measurable. Providers report higher rates of suitable referrals and less near-misses. Staff record lowered anxiousness regarding "getting it incorrect," which subsequently aids them remain present with the individual in distress.

The duty of first aid for psychological health

Physical first aid is foundational throughout markets. The same logic applies to first aid in mental health. A first aid mental health course is not psychotherapy, and it ought to never indicate that ordinary -responders take on medical duties. Rather, it outfits staff to stabilize the circumstance, minimize immediate threat, and connect the person to suitable support promptly. Clarity about extent stops injury. Approved first aid for mental health courses make that border specific and practice it via scenarios.

I suggest organizations to look for first aid for mental health course alternatives that include live technique, not simply e-learning. The moments that count, like inquiring about self-destruction or establishing limitations with empathy, are behavioral. You learn them by claiming the words out loud, receiving responses, and attempting once again until your distribution is steady.

The limits of training and where judgment comes in

Accredited training is necessary, not sufficient. Mental wellness work asks for judgment in uncertain problems. You may satisfy a person whose risk fluctuates hour to hour. You might require accredited mental health courses in Australia to balance freedom with duty of care, or hold your nerve while waiting on an ambulance that is 40 minutes out. Educating supplies frameworks, however you will certainly still face gray zones. Good courses prepare you for uncertainty and instruct you to consult early, paper completely, and choose the least restrictive secure option.

There are trade-offs. Over-escalating to emergency solutions can distress an individual and damage trust fund. Under-escalating can put them in jeopardy. The appropriate phone call relies on specifics: accessibility to ways, immediacy of intent, offered support, and the individual's ability in the minute. Accredited training minimizes guesswork by standardizing just how you gather those specifics, then express them in a security plan or handover.

A brief instance example

A college consultant meets a pupil that has actually fallen short 2 projects and shows up taken out. During a routine check-in, the trainee mentions not resting and feeling like a problem. The advisor, educated with an approved emergency treatment in mental health course, asks direct inquiries regarding self-harm. The student admits to searching for techniques however has no concrete strategy. The expert uses the risk structure from training: evaluates ways, intent, duration, and safety factors. They co-create a same-day strategy involving a school general practitioner, the counseling solution, and a trusted good friend who consents to stay that night. The expert documents the discussion using the training theme and books a follow-up for the next morning.

Nothing because scenario is significant, however small choices add up. Without training, the expert might have supplied research suggestions and a hotline number. With training, they determined danger, produced a particular plan, and developed liability right into follow-up. That is what accredited training resembles in the wild.
